Details for Megapixels (Total Image Resolution)

Introduction : Represents the total number of pixels (in millions) in a digital image. Determines the maximum printable size and detail retention.

History & Origin : Popularized with consumer digital cameras in the 1990s (e.g., 1MP in 1991 to 100MP+ in modern medium-format cameras).

Current Use : Standard for camera marketing (e.g., 24MP DSLRs), smartphone cameras, and image editing workflows. Affects file size and cropping flexibility.

Details for Dots per Square Inch (Area Printing Resolution)

Introduction : Measures the total dots per square inch in printing, accounting for both horizontal and vertical dot placement. Critical for color depth and gradient quality.

History & Origin : Developed for high-end color printers in the 1990s to quantify ink coverage (e.g., 1200×1200 DPI = 1,440,000 dot/in²).

Current Use : Used in fine art printing (2M+ dot/in² for photo realism) and industrial inkjet systems where ink droplet density affects output quality.
